指通過編程語言和開發工具創建一款應用程序,APP開發可以在移動設備上運行。APP開發可以分為兩個主要方面:前端開發和后端開發。前端開發主要負責用戶界面的設計和交互,后端開發則負責處理數據和邏輯。
在APP開發中,最常用的編程語言包括Java、Swift和Kotlin。Java是Android平臺的主要編程語言,而Swift和Kotlin則分別是iOS和Android平臺的官方編程語言。開發工具包括Android Studio、Xcode和Eclipse等。
在開始APP開發之前,首先需要明確應用的目標和功能。然后,可以進行以下步驟來開發APP:
1. 需求分析:明確應用的需求和目標,包括用戶界面設計、功能需求和技術要求等。
2. 原型設計:使用專業的設計工具,如Sketch或Adobe XD等,設計應用的用戶界面和交互流程。
3. 數據庫設計:根據應用的需求,設計數據庫結構,包括表的字段、關系和索引等。
4. 前端開發:使用所選的編程語言和開發工具,根據設計的原型,開發應用的前端界面。這包括布局、樣式和交互等。
5. 后端開發:根據應用的需求,使用所選的編程語言和框架,開發應用的后端邏輯和數據處理。這包括數據的存儲和讀取、用戶認證和授權等。
6. 測試和調試:在開發過程中,進行測試和調試,確保應用的功能和性能符合預期。
7. 發布和部署:將開發完成的應用打包,并發布到相應的應用商店或平臺上。這包括應用的簽名、版本管理和發布流程等。
8. 運營和維護:發布后,需要進行運營和維護工作,包括用戶反饋處理、bug修復和功能更新等。
在APP開發過程中,還需要了解一些基礎知識和技術,如UI設計、網絡通信、數據存儲和安全等。同時,也要了解移動設備的特性和限制,以提高應用的性能和用戶體驗。
總結來說,APP開發是一個復雜的過程,需要掌握多種技術和工具。通過合理的規劃和實踐,可以開發出功能完善、用戶友好的應用程序。